The Sims 4's Next Game Pack has Revealed in a Leak.

The Sims 4 is getting yet another DLC pack, according to a recent leak, with pictures indicating that it will likely be focused on weddings this time.

The Sims series has been around for 22 years, which makes the fact that it is only on its fourth main installment all the more unexpected. Part of the reason for this is because there's always a need for more content in the form of DLC expansion packs, which each edition has been glad to give. The next DLC for The Sims 4 has been revealed by a leaker, bringing the total number of expansions to an even dozen and allowing Sims to be married in style.

The Sims 4 DLC packs have already presented a lot of extra features and settings, going from islands to cities to cottage living. The majority of the packs provide a brand-new environment to explore, and if that isn't enough, there's also a choice of content to purchase, such as game packs, stuff packs, and kits.

According to leakers on Twitter who discovered this information in a "dark area" and posted happy marital photographs, the latest DLC is now dubbed The Sims 4 'My Wedding Stories' DLC. Given how important keeping friendships is in a Sims game, it's odd that this feature didn't arrive sooner, but it appears to be jam-packed with everything a player could want. Planning the wedding, selecting 'Sims of Honor' for the ceremony, the engagement dinner, rehearsal, and even a bachelor/bachelorette party are among the highlights. The DLC pack will reportedly include a newer environment called Tartosa, which will be a romantic vacation for Sims. Hopefully, players will know how to cultivate their Sims' relationships in order for this to happen.

The Sims 4 has been out for nearly eight years, and it shows no signs of slowing down. EA has discovered a goldmine with these nonstop DLC pack releases, and fans continue to demonstrate a strong interest in them, so there's no reason to produce a new game. That's not to suggest a sequel won't happen, but EA has stated that The Sims 5 was farther away than people believe.

One of the reasons players keep coming back to The Sims 4 is that there isn't much competition in the life simulator category. While games like Animal Crossing and Stardew Valley are addictive in their own right, no other game offers a huge level of personalization and choices like The Sims 4 players do. Some gamers like nurturing their relationships, while others simply use it to imitate iconic architecture or live a life they would not have been able to live otherwise. It might as well be the only game in town right now, and the never-ending DLC has surely contributed to that.

The Sims 4 is currently available for PC, PlayStation 4, PlayStation 5, Xbox One, and Xbox Series X/S.
